| package org.codehaus.groovy.runtime; |
| |
| import java.awt.*; |
| import java.beans.PropertyChangeListener; |
| import java.beans.PropertyChangeSupport; |
| import java.util.HashMap; |
| import java.util.Map; |
| |
| /** |
| * A bean used by the test cases |
| * |
| * @author <a href="mailto:james@coredevelopers.net">James Strachan</a> |
| * @author <a href="mailto:shemnon@yahoo.com">Danno Ferrin</a> |
| * @version $Revision$ |
| */ |
| public class DummyBean { |
| private String name = "James"; |
| private Integer i = new Integer(123); |
| private Map dynamicProperties = new HashMap(); |
| private Point point; |
| private PropertyChangeSupport changeSupport = new PropertyChangeSupport(this); |
| |
| public DummyBean() { |
| } |
| |
| public DummyBean(String name) { |
| this.name = name; |
| } |
| |
| public DummyBean(String name, Integer i) { |
| this.name = name; |
| this.i = i; |
| } |
| |
| public void addPropertyChangeListener(PropertyChangeListener listener) { |
| changeSupport.addPropertyChangeListener(listener); |
| } |
| |
| public Integer getI() { |
| return i; |
| } |
| |
| public void setI(Integer i) { |
| changeSupport.firePropertyChange("i", this.i, this.i = i); |
| } |
| |
| public String getName() { |
| return name; |
| } |
| |
| public void setName(String name) { |
| changeSupport.firePropertyChange("name", this.name, this.name = name); |
| } |
| |
| // dynamic properties |
| public Object get(String property) { |
| return dynamicProperties.get(property); |
| } |
| |
| public void set(String property, Object newValue) { |
| dynamicProperties.put(property, newValue); |
| } |
| |
| public static String dummyStaticMethod(String text) { |
| return text.toUpperCase(); |
| } |
| |
| public boolean equals(Object that) { |
| if (that instanceof DummyBean) { |
| return equals((DummyBean) that); |
| } |
| return false; |
| } |
| |
| public boolean equals(DummyBean that) { |
| return this.name.equals(that.name) && this.i.equals(that.i); |
| } |
| |
| public String toString() { |
| return super.toString() + "[name=" + name + ";i=" + i + "]"; |
| } |
| |
| public Point getPoint() { |
| return point; |
| } |
| |
| public void setPoint(Point point) { |
| changeSupport.firePropertyChange("point", this.point, this.point = point); |
| } |
| |
| } |
